L913 HBL is a 1993 Renault 5 in White with a 1,390c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 3 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 1993 Renault 5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.2% with a typical mileage of 72,423 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ault 5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,884 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L913 HBL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ault 5 typically stays on UK roads for around 42 years. At 33 years old, this Renault 5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
